Expert Verdict
Aminobenzoate-class UV filters are associated with photoallergy and phototoxicity risks; PABA and several PABA esters have been largely phased out due to sensitization concerns.. The dimethylcyclohexenylmethyl group suggests a terpenoid-like hydrophobic moiety, which would improve oil solubility and substantivity on skin.

What does Ethyl 2-Dimethylcyclohexenylmethyl-Aminobenzoate do in cosmetics?
Ethyl 2-Dimethylcyclohexenylmethyl-Aminobenzoate functions as: Likely a UV absorber / UV filter based on its aminobenzoate (PABA-derivative) moiety. Aminobenzoate esters are a well-known class of UV-B absorbing compounds.. It is classified as a cosmetic ingredient in our database. CAS number: Not confirmed from available sources.
